15.
which one of the cells shown is eukaryotic?
the cell that contains the ribosomes
the cell that contains cytoplasm
the cell that contains the nucleus
the cell that does not contain the nucleus
Brief Explanations
To determine the eukaryotic cell, we use the key characteristic of eukaryotic cells: they have a true nucleus (enclosed by a nuclear membrane) and membrane - bound organelles.
- Option A: Both prokaryotic and eukaryotic cells have ribosomes, so this is not a distinguishing feature.
- Option B: Both prokaryotic and eukaryotic cells have cytoplasm, so this is not a distinguishing feature.
- Option C: Eukaryotic cells have a nucleus (a membrane - bound organelle that contains genetic material), while prokaryotic cells have a nucleoid (a region with genetic material but no nuclear membrane). So the cell with a nucleus is eukaryotic.
- Option D: Prokaryotic cells also do not have a nucleus (they have a nucleoid), so this describes a prokaryotic cell.
